Obituary for Lawrence "Larry" Furnari Jr.

Lawrence “Larry” Furnari, Jr, 69, of Sterling Heights Michigan, formerly of Belmont passed away suddenly on Friday, March 15th, 2024 at his home. He was born to the late Lawrence Furnari, Sr. And Angelina C. Furnari (Puntonio) on January 14th, 1955, in Cambridge, MA.

Larry has always had an appreciation and passion for anything to do with automobiles and their inner workings. He could talk at length about cars without tiring, offering his knowledge and advice when asked. Even as a little boy, he could distinguish a car make, model and year by just looking at it. Shortly after graduating in 1977 from Tufts University with a bachelor's degree in mechanical engineering, he put his passions to work by moving to the Motor City (Detroit, MI) and obtaining his dream job with Chrysler Corporation where his love for cars became a daily part of his life. Chrysler sold the division he worked for to General Dynamics several years later, where Larry remained until his retirement a few years ago.

Above all, Larry loved his family and friends. We all loved him and will miss him. Even though he moved many miles away to the Detroit area, he took care to drive back (never fly) to Belmont to visit his parents, sisters and nieces several times a year.
Predeceased by his beloved parents Lawrence and Angelina Furnari (Puntonio) of Belmont.

Larry is survived by his loving sisters, Cathy Piccolo and her husband Dennis of Burlington, MA, Linda Furnari of Belmont, MA, his adoring nieces, Karen Polcaro and her husband Gino of Groton, MA, Lauren Porter and her husband Ryan of Burlington, MA and Catherine Cerullo and her husband Brian also of Burlington. In addition, he had several great nieces and nephews. Larry also had a close-knit group of friends in the Detroit area that were very dear and special to him.
